    The Hydrogen Energy Electric V-Ball Valve is a type of control valve designed specifically for managing the flow of hydrogen in energy systems. Unlike traditional valves, the V-Ball Valve features a spherical ball with a V-shaped slot that rotates to control flow. This design provides superior flow control and precision, essential for handling the unique properties of hydrogen.

    Hydrogen, as a fuel, has gained prominence due to its high energy content and zero-emission profile when used in fuel cells. However, its use poses specific challenges, primarily because of its low density and high flammability. The Hydrogen Energy Electric V-Ball Valve is engineered to address these challenges by offering a robust solution for precise flow regulation and safety.
